HOLISM AND WELLNESS: Holism takes into account the mind, body and spirit of the individual. All aspects must be in balance and harmony in order for true healing to occur. One’s state of well being (ease or dis-ease) includes belief systems, thoughts, lifestyle, relationship, attitudes, energy and spirituality, as well as the physical body. These attributes are not static states, but are ever-changing conditions where, on any given day one may place oneself on a health continuum ranging from “sick” to feeling “just ok” to high level wellness.
Where Are You Today?
Just because one has no clinical symptoms does not mean that everything is fine. Often symptoms that are measurable from blood tests and other diagnostics are the LAST thing to appear. The body gives lots of warning signs, often vague feelings such as fatigue, indigestion, worsening allergies or chronic soft tissue pain, etc., that signals all is not well. These types of things are what a vast majority of people walk around with every day. They are not “clinically” sick but they know they could feel better.
Holistic approaches work at these levels. They help you reach that place where you know you could and would like to be.

Biography - Rachel Lord, RN,MH,CMT,CR
I am a registered nurse and have worked in critical care for 15 years. My interest in holistic health has blossomed over the years, particularly as I watched many people in the ICU return again and again for the same or related symptoms, just worse.
This was particularly true with chronic illnesses. (Trauma was and is handled well in the western setting.) I wondered why little was done on a preventative level when there is so much information out there. Why did the same person return for multiple heart bypasses, for instance.
Along the way I became a certified massage therapist CMT and then taught it at the Massage Therapy Institute of Colorado. I became a nationally certified Reflexologist and now teach it as well. I have also studied clinical nutrition and medical herbalism and am a Master Herbalist MH with an in-house herbal pharmacy.
